What is five billion in scientific notation?

Five billion in scientific notation is written as 5 x 10^9. In scientific notation, the number is expressed as a coefficient (5) multiplied by 10 raised to the power of the exponent (9), representing the number of zeroes in the original number (five billion). This notation is commonly used in scientific and mathematical calculations to simplify large numbers.
